ZIP Code 58102
ZIP / ZCTA
Population: 32,591
ZIP Code Tabulation Areas (ZCTAs) are Census approximations of USPS ZIP codes. Boundaries may differ slightly from postal delivery areas, and estimates for less-populated ZCTAs carry higher margins of error.
Data: U.S. Census Bureau, ACS 5-Year Estimates, 2023 (released December 2024).
Quick Facts — 58102
- What is the median household income in 58102?
-
The median household income in 58102 is $56,028 (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ates, 2023).
- What is the poverty rate in 58102?
-
The poverty rate in 58102 is 7.2% (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What is the median home value in 58102?
-
$235,600 (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What is the average rent in 58102?
-
The median gross rent in 58102 is $829 per month (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What percentage of 58102 residents have a college degree?
-
45.5% of adults in 58102 hold a bachelor's degree or higher (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
